## Wrenfield API — Environments & Pagination Notes

Quick context for the security review: the public Wrenfield REST API paginates with opaque cursors in prod, but staging still accepts raw offset params for legacy test suites — yes, we know, it's on the kill list. Cursor tokens are signed and expire after ten minutes, so enumeration attempts should fall over quickly. Page sizes are clamped server-side regardless of what clients ask for. The staging environment runs with the following settings.

service settings:
PRAIX_LOG_LEVEL=error
PRAIX_METRICS_HOST=metrics.praix.qorvelcorp.corp
PRAIX_POOL_SIZE=16

## Formula sandbox tuning

User-supplied formulas in Gridmoor execute inside a restricted interpreter with hard ceilings on time, memory, and call depth. Reviewers should confirm any change to these ceilings is justified in the PR description, since raising them widens the abuse surface. Defaults were chosen from production traces. The current limits are as follows.

limits module of tafog-fawip:
WEIGHTS = {
    "julix": 57,
    "lamys": 992,
    "kasvan": 209,
    "quenok": 750,
    "alddor": 259,
    "oliath": 1009,
    "wenix": 815,
}

Wellness Room — Night Shift Booking

The wellness room on Level 2 of Brindlemere House is bookable overnight in one-hour slots via the Quillon system. Always confirm the previous occupant has signed out, check the lighting panel is reset, and note any issues in the shift log. The door remains locked between bookings and requires the entry code below.

staff pass of kawip-hawef = bdg-QLP-2

Subject: Quickstore 4.2 — bloom filter now fronts the KV layer

Plugin authors: starting with this release, Quickstore places a bloom filter ahead of the key-value store. Negative lookups return faster; false positives fall through safely. No API changes are required on your side. Verify your plugin against the staging build referenced below.

session token of fahif-tadup = htk3_9c7

## Eng Sync — Cron Migration Notes

Discussed moving the remaining cron jobs onto the Loomwork workflow engine. Agreed to migrate the reporting jobs first, keeping cron as fallback for two weeks. Retry semantics and alert routing still need a design doc before cutover. Accountability for the migration plan sits with the engineer named below.

named custodian: Belius Casath Ulaix Sorius